--  Actions to Preserve Your Vision

What can you do to preserve your vision? While there is no foolproof system to prevent retinopathy, whether you have type 1 or type 2 diabetes, the important things to do are:


  • Keep your A1C level below 7%.
  • Keep your blood pressure at or below 130/80 mm Hg.
  • If you smoke—stop.
  • Have at least annual, complete dilated eye examinations by an eye doctor experienced in diagnosing and managing diabetic eye disease.
  • If there is a problem, seek early treatment. Remember that appropriate laser treatment and surgery can significantly reduce the risk of vision loss and blindness from diabetes.
  • Control other associated risk factors for onset or progression of retinopathy, including kidney disease, anemia, high cholesterol, and abdominal obesity.
